Where the trunk stood decides it, not where the branches were

Whose stump is it when the tree straddled a boundary, what Georgia practice generally holds, and the practical way neighbours sort it out.

This comes up more than you would think, particularly in older Woodstock neighbourhoods where the trees predate the fences. The short version of how it generally works in Georgia: ownership follows the trunk at ground level.

If the trunk stood entirely on one side of the line, it was that owner’s tree, and the stump is theirs to deal with. Branches overhanging your garden and roots running under it never made it partly yours. A neighbour is generally entitled to trim back to the boundary, but trimming is not ownership.

If the trunk genuinely straddled the line, it is usually treated as jointly owned, and neither owner can simply remove it without the other. In practice that means the cost of dealing with what is left is a conversation rather than an entitlement.

Where it turns contentious is damage. If a tree was visibly dead or dangerous and the owner was told so and did nothing, that changes the picture considerably when it falls. If it was healthy and a storm took it, that is generally treated as an act of nature and each owner deals with what landed on their side.

None of the above is legal advice, and a boundary dispute that actually matters is worth twenty minutes with a Georgia property solicitor rather than an article. But it is the framework most of these conversations start from.

The practical answer, which resolves the overwhelming majority of these: get one quote for the whole job and split it. A boundary stump is one grind, one callout fee, and one machine. Two separate jobs on the same stump is not a thing, and two neighbours each paying half of one callout is cheaper for both than either of them paying a full one later. It is also a much better conversation to have over a fence than the alternative.

If you are the one arranging it, get the quote in writing with the address and the stump described, so what is being split is unambiguous.

How much does stump grinding cost in Woodstock?

Crews in the Atlanta metro quote three to five dollars per inch of stump diameter, with a minimum of one hundred to two hundred dollars to bring the machine out. A typical residential stump lands between one hundred fifty and three hundred dollars. Large or hard to reach stumps run three hundred to five hundred and up.

How do I measure my stump?

Measure straight across the widest point at ground level, including the flare, not the trunk higher up. People routinely underestimate by six or eight inches because they measure the wrong place, then get a quote that feels high.

How deep does the grinding go?

Four to six inches below grade is standard, which is enough to fill with topsoil and grow grass. If you are setting a fence post, pouring concrete or laying sod, ask for twelve inches or more and say what is going in that spot.

Will the crew fit into my back yard?

A standard walk-behind grinder needs roughly thirty six inches of clearance. Measure your gate before you call. If it is narrower, the crew brings a smaller machine or hand-clears a path, and that changes the price more than stump size does.

What happens to the wood chips?

Grinding produces more chips than the hole will hold. Leaving them on site is free and most people spread them as mulch. Hauling them away is an extra charge, so ask up front rather than at the end.
